What Makes Anionic Polyacrylamide Emulsion So Effective?

Unlike traditional powder polymers, the emulsion form of anionic polyacrylamide offers rapid dissolution, easy handling, and superior dispersion. This allows for more uniform floc formation in high-speed industrial processes and improves overall treatment outcomes.

Key advantages of using the emulsion format include:

• Faster mixing and activation
• Better performance in high-solids wastewater
• Reduced equipment wear due to lower shear needs
• Compatibility with automated dosing systems

These benefits make the emulsion ideal for industries such as chemical manufacturing, textiles, mining, and oil processing.

Are You Using It the Right Way?

Despite its advantages, improper dosing, poor emulsion inversion, or incorrect polymer selection can significantly limit performance. Here are three questions every facility should ask:

  1. Is the polymer fully activated before application?

  2. Are you matching polymer charge density to your effluent profile?

  3. Have you evaluated dosage based on real-time process changes?

If the answer to any of these is “no” or “not sure,” you may be wasting valuable resources.
